GNP 100

Fully automatic profile sharpening machine for gangsaw blades controlled with 2 CNC axes


The space-saving GNP 100 sets new standards in the grinding of gang saw blades. By means of the acoustic sensor and the W-axis, the zero points can be measured automatically. The saw neck can be programmed and can be machined automatically.

Highlights

  • Profile-grinding of standard and Stellite-tipped band saw blades by means of CNC axes "W" & "Y" (grinding of the positioned and clamped saw tooth)
  • Pneumatic saw blade clamping all over the whole saw blade length
  • Precision spindle height adjustment for saw width
  • Full-space cover with intensive water cooling
  • "LINUX Debian 10" control unit with multicore processor
  • Drive by means of servo motors
  • Use of linear roller guides for all CNC axes (stiffer engineering and maximized lifetime)
  • Extensive grinding programmes
  • Automatic probing of the grinding wheel at the saw tooth
  • Tooth profiles retrievable via control unit (standard memory for 99’999 tooth profiles)

Technical data

Tooth shape:freely programmable
Tooth pitch:5 - 60 mm
Tooth height:up to 30 mm
Front rake angle:0° - 25°
Blade width:80 - 180 mm 
Blade length (toothed length):up to 1500 mm 
  
Grinding wheel:Ø 350 mm 
Grinding wheel bore:Ø 32 mm 
Grinding wheel Motor:2,2 kW
  
Power requirement:400V 3Ph N, 50Hz, 2,4kVA
Air connection:6 bar
Coolant tank:170 l
